Technically this shouldn't be required since VDD_1V8 is always on
anyway, but I think it's nicer to specify regulators anyway, so +1!
Reviewed-by: Mikko Perttunen <mperttunen@nvidia.com>
On 20.07.2018 15:45, Aapo Vienamo wrote:
> On p2180 sdmmc4 is powered from a fixed 1.8 V regulator.
>
> Signed-off-by: Aapo Vienamo <avienamo@nvidia.com>
> ---
> arch/arm64/boot/dts/nvidia/tegra210-p2180.dtsi | 1 +
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>
> di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/nvidia/tegra210-p2180.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/nvidia/tegra210-p2180.dtsi
> index 8496101..053458a 100644
> --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/nvidia/tegra210-p2180.dtsi
> +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/nvidia/tegra210-p2180.dtsi
> @@ -273,6 +273,7 @@
> status = "okay";
> bus-width = <8>;
> non-removable;
> + vqmmc-supply = <&vdd_1v8>;
> };
